Handover Note — Warranty Overrun, Kestrel Pumps
From: D. Marchetti, outgoing. To: L. Vane, incoming.
Warranty costs on the Kestrel K-40 line are 38% over plan, driven by seal failures from the Arbol plant batch. Reserve topped up last month; expect one more adjustment. Claims pipeline tracked weekly by finance ops. Supplier recovery talks stalled — push Torven Components hard. Root-cause report due month-end. Read the restricted note below before your first supplier call.

board note of tadup-tajog: Headcount on the Oliiel team goes from 31 to 88 by the end of February. Gross margin on Oliiel came in at 62 percent against a plan of 29 percent.

# Diffwide Contacts

Support folks: Diffwide is our large-file diff viewer. If a customer hits the "file too big to render" wall, that's expected above 500 MB — point them at chunked mode. Garbled rendering or crashes are bugs; grab the file size and format before escalating. For anything you can't triage, write the viewer team.

alerts address for kajef-bagap: istax.fraath@zemvarcorp.corp

## Deploying the Gatewick Proctor Queue

Deploys are pretty painless: push to main, wait for the pipeline, then watch the queue drain dashboard for five minutes. If candidates pile up mid-exam, roll back first and ask questions later — the queue replays safely. Everything the workers care about lives in one config block, shown here for reference.

settings of bafof-yagef:
JOROX_PIN=8740
JOROX_TENANT=pelox
JOROX_METRICS_HOST=metrics.jorox.qorvelworks.internal
JOROX_SEAL=seal_c78f63c1
JOROX_STANDBY_TEAM=norax

## Package Scanner: SquatGuard

As on-call, you own SquatGuard, our scanner that flags typo-squatted packages entering the Brindlewood registry. It compares new package names against a curated allowlist using edit-distance and homoglyph checks, then quarantines suspects for manual review. False positives are common with abbreviations, so triage carefully before releasing anything. Escalation criteria and the quarantine review workflow are documented here:

operations page: https://jenkins.zemvarcloud.local/job/merge_requests/repo/build/73930b4b30f0a8ed